    Traditional Peruvian Cuisine in Ollantaytambo

    Peruvian cuisine is known for its bold flavors and vibrant colors, and Ollantaytambo is no exception. Traditional dishes like ceviche, lomo saltado, and ají de gallina are staples of the local cuisine. Visitors can find these dishes on menus throughout the town, often made with fresh, locally-sourced ingredients.

    Must-Try Dishes in Ollantaytambo

    Here are some must-try dishes in Ollantaytambo:

    • Ceviche: A classic Peruvian dish made with raw fish marinated in citrus juices, often served with onions, tomatoes, and aji amarillo peppers.
    • Lomo Saltado: A stir-fry dish made with beef, onions, tomatoes, and French fries, served with rice and a side of ají amarillo sauce.
    • Ají de Gallina: A creamy chicken dish made with shredded chicken cooked in aji amarillo pepper sauce, served with rice and boiled potatoes.
